Crystal Structure of the Sarcin/Ricin Domain from E. COLI 23 S rRNA, U2650-SECH3 modified
Template:ABSTRACT PUBMED 19228585
About this Structure
3dw6 is a 1 chain structure. Full crystallographic information is available from OCA.
Reference
- Olieric V, Rieder U, Lang K, Serganov A, Schulze-Briese C, Micura R, Dumas P, Ennifar E. A fast selenium derivatization strategy for crystallization and phasing of RNA structures. RNA. 2009 Apr;15(4):707-15. Epub 2009 Feb 18. PMID:19228585 doi:10.1261/rna.1499309
